Petra A. Link is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Hematology. According to data from OpenAlex, Petra A. Link has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 675 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Cancer Research and 2 papers in Hematology. Recurrent topics in Petra A. Link’s work include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(10 papers), Cancer-related gene regulation (6 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(5 papers). Petra A. Link is often cited by papers focused on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(10 papers), Cancer-related gene regulation (6 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(5 papers). Petra A. Link coll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Japan. Petra A. Link's co-authors include Adam R. Karpf, Smitha R. James, Kunle Odunsi, Anna Woloszynska‐Read, Wa Zhang, Jihnhee Yu, Ji‐Yeob Choi, Chi-Chen Hong, Warren Davis and Christine B. Ambrosone and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, Cancer Research and Oncogene.
